Calibration of lux meters, energy meters, and infrared thermometers ensures measurement accuracy that is legally traceable to national standards — a mandatory requirement for ISO 9001/ISO 17025 compliance, BEE energy audit validity, and NABL laboratory accreditation.
According to the National Accreditation Board for Testing and Calibration Laboratories (NABL), approximately 35% of industrial instruments operating in Indian facilities show measurement errors exceeding ±5% after 12 months of use without recalibration — errors large enough to invalidate energy audit results, LEED assessments, and quality control decisions. The Bureau of Indian Standards (BIS) mandates calibration traceability under IS/IEC 17025:2017 for any laboratory or facility issuing measurement-based compliance reports.
A world-class design and engineering organisation in Gurgaon recently discovered through calibration audit that its reference energy meter had drifted +3.8% over 18 months — meaning 18 months of energy consumption data used for LEED Gold certification baseline was systematically overstated, requiring ₹2.8 lakhs in recalculation and re-reporting work. Similarly, four IR thermometers used for electrical panel inspections showed readings 4–7°C below actual temperature — meaning several hot spots that should have triggered maintenance were classified as normal.
Haryana’s industrial sector, particularly Gurgaon’s dense concentration of MNC engineering organisations, R&D facilities, and design consultancies, faces increasing client and regulatory scrutiny of measurement traceability. ISO 9001:2015 Clause 7.1.5 mandates calibration with defined intervals and documented traceability — a requirement audited by bodies like Bureau Veritas, TÜV SÜD, and DNV during ISO surveillance audits.
Instrument Calibration Services Cost & Frequency
NABL-traceable calibration for lux meters costs ₹800–₹1,500/instrument; energy meters ₹1,500–₹3,500; IR thermometers ₹1,200–₹2,500. Annual calibration is mandatory under ISO 9001 Clause 7.1.5 and IS/IEC 17025. Uncalibrated instruments invalidate energy audit reports and can trigger ISO non-conformances during surveillance audits.
Scope of Work
Elion Technologies and Consulting Pvt Ltd meticulously designed a comprehensive calibration plan to address the client’s specific requirements. The scope of work included:
- Lux Meter Calibration:
- Rigorous testing of Lux meters to ensure accurate measurement of illuminance.
- Calibration adjustments for sensitivity, linearity, and overall performance.
- Compliance verification with industry standards.
- Energy Meter Calibration:
- Calibration of energy meters for precise measurement of electrical consumption.
- Verification of accuracy in both low and high load conditions.
- Calibration certificates issued for compliance documentation.
- Infrared Thermometer Calibration:
- Calibration of Infrared Thermometers to guarantee accurate temperature readings.
- Evaluation of emissivity settings and adjustments as needed.
- Testing under various environmental conditions to ensure reliability.
